target weight 75kg
1.6 g/kg  = 120 g/day
1.8 g/kg  = 135 g/day
spread over 4 feeds = 30-34 g each
which with no appetite is the actual problem

i lift three times a week and my lifts dropped about ten percent while losing, then came back up

the risk with fast loss is lean mass, and the two things that touch it are protein and resistance work
